Sergio Perez podium 'hard to swallow' - Esteban Ocon

Force India's Esteban Ocon has admitted that Sergio Perez's podium at the Azerbaijan Grand Prix was 'a hard one to swallow' although the Frenchman believes that he will have other chances to finish in the top three this season.
